0
いくつかのサイトでcURLを使用しているときに、私が実際に要求したファイルのいくつかは、私がcurlで設定したクッキーの変数を使用していたことに気付きました。クッキーにはいくつのバーがあるべきですか?
ここでスナップショットです:
しかし、私は私のクッキーファイルをチェックするとき、それは読み込みがすべてASP.NET_SessionIdのためだけの一つの値である:
もちろんwww.*******.*** FALSE/FALSE 0 ASP.NET_SessionId ddj24l55lfu11nb1lhuflw55
、値(Internet Explorer F12)から取得され、そのCookieには3つの変数(1つではない)が含まれています。 Internet ExplorerのF12クッキー変数名/値:
NAME ASPSESSIONIDSACRDADD
VALUE LOONCEMDHCGEJOANEGHHFAFH
NAME ASPSESSIONIDSCBRABDC
VALUE CMONJEMDNICPNPNFICLAPMFM
NAME ASPSESSIONIDQACSBADC
VALUE MCBOGLCCKNIDDBOADNMPCLCD
これはクッキーのための私のCURLの設定です:
$cookiefile = "d:/cookie.txt";
curl_setopt($curl, CURLOPT_COOKIESESSION, 1);
curl_setopt($curl, CURLOPT_COOKIEFILE, $cookiefile);
curl_setopt($curl, CURLOPT_COOKIEJAR, $cookiefile);
それは私がカールをmissinginできることは何ですか?
ありがとうございます!
いつこれらのクッキーが届きましたか?彼らはおそらく古いセッションの古くなったクッキーで、ブラウザが送信しているものの、サーバーは実際にはそれ以上は興味がありません。これらのクッキーはブラウザツールを見てどこにでも置かれていますか? – deceze
はもっと正確ではありませんでした。どうもありがとうございます。私はキャッシュをクリアし、もう一度クッキーに戻ります。 – Ted